    One pec bigger then the other..

    Alright well, I was just taking pictures of my body to show my progress, and i noticed, one of my pec's is bigger then the other..
    wtfhax?
    The left one is bigger then my right one.
    Now i've already used the search button, and I read that this is because i'm right handed and when i'm doing my dumbell flyes my right delt is doing more work because it is stronger then my left delt. Therefor the left pec is getting more of a workout..

    I would like to know if anyone else had this problem and how they fixed it

    i had same problem but now i fixed it.

    Its your form when you bench your bench on an angle hitting on pec more and the other tricep more, also your right handed im guessing? your right delt is taking over the movement.

    Correct form and keep bar straight if you cant use the machine, keep elbows in excact same place..

    Having elbows posistioned slightly different causes you to hit the pecs harder/not as hard.

    use smith machine and look at form in mirror, then go back to bench when you got form correct.
